Ir para conteúdo

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

gijunior

Sistema que importar arquivo texto para SQL SERVER 2005

Recommended Posts

Boa tarde pessoal,

Estou com uma dúvida aqui como eu importo arquivo texto e envio para o sql server?

Mais o arquivo texto esta de forma diferente vou postar aqui

e também após importar os arquivo o sistema tem que informar qual a sequencia que foi usada.

Pois no bd tem a opção quando adicioono o arquivo ele informa a sequencia.

A linguagem é VB ou DELPHI Obrigado.

 

O sistema ele tem que eliminar o nome loja, e total.

Ai o próprio sistema vai jogar no cadastro do cliente o cliente que esta cdadastrado aqui juntamente com o endereço.

Caso o cliente existe ele informa que existe e informa o código do cliente.

 

Nos campos abaixo ele vai pegar os produtos cód, valor.

Aguardo retorno

 

junior@infoshop.eti.br

 

Loja =

Cliente = Alexandre/Karina

Endereco =

Bairro =

Cidade =

CEP =

Fone =

CPF =

EEntrega =

Obs =

1 3 26.552.984 Bancada CPU 683.36 274.44 87.70 Dormitorios 300 736 580

2 73.6 29.987.984 Base Prateleira Linear - 736mm 51.67 20.75 0.27 Dormitorios 736 18 300

3 73.6 29.987.984 Base Prateleira Linear - 736mm 51.67 20.75 0.27 Dormitorios 736 18 300

4 73.6 29.987.984 Base Prateleira Linear - 736mm 51.67 20.75 0.27 Dormitorios 736 18 300

5 55 24.006.984 Prateleira Divisor Ambiente Linea 101.45 40.74 0.71 Complementos 550 40 250

6 50 24.006.984 Prateleira Divisor Ambiente Linea 92.26 37.05 0.71 Complementos 500 40 250

7 50 24.006.984 Prateleira Divisor Ambiente Linea 92.26 37.05 0.71 Complementos 500 40 250

8 55 24.006.984 Prateleira Divisor Ambiente Linea 101.45 40.74 0.71 Complementos 550 40 250

9 2 89.301.984 Prateleira p/ Tamponamento/Fecham 136.31 54.74 26.23 Cozinhas 960 25 75

10 255 89.010.984 Regua Horizontal H=100mm 212.00 85.14 0.32 Complementos 2550 100 25

11 30 89.010.984 Regua Horizontal H=100mm 24.98 10.03 0.32 Complementos 300 100 25

12 255 89.010.984 Regua Horizontal H=100mm 212.00 85.14 0.32 Complementos 2550 100 25

13 120 89.020.984 Regua Horizontal H=300mm 137.20 55.10 0.44 Complementos 1200 300 25

14 120 89.020.984 Regua Horizontal H=430mm 137.20 55.10 0.44 Complementos 1200 430 25

15 120 89.030.984 Regua Horizontal H=670mm 196.39 78.87 0.63 Complementos 1200 670 25

16 120 89.030.984 Regua Horizontal H=670mm 196.39 78.87 0.63 Complementos 1200 670 25

17 120 89.030.984 Regua Horizontal H=670mm 196.39 78.87 0.63 Complementos 1200 670 25

18 73.6 24.060.984 Tampo Reto Linear 183.54 73.71 0.96 Complementos 736 40 600

19 130 24.060.984 Tampo Reto Linear 324.18 130.19 0.96 Complementos 1300 40 600

20 73.6 24.060.984 Tampo Reto Linear 183.54 73.71 0.96 Complementos 736 40 600

21 130 24.060.984 Tampo Reto Linear 324.18 130.19 0.96 Complementos 1300 40 600

22 130 24.060.984 Tampo Reto Linear 324.18 130.19 0.96 Complementos 1300 40 600

23 73.6 24.060.984 Tampo Reto Linear 183.54 73.71 0.96 Complementos 736 40 600

Total = 4197.81

Compartilhar este post


Link para o post
Compartilhar em outros sites

não entendi, muito bem a sua dúvida... você mesmo que fazer um programa para importação? ou você está buscando alguém que possa fazer isto?

 

segue abaixo meu contato

jolienai@bol.com.br

(11) 7605-1358

Compartilhar este post


Link para o post
Compartilhar em outros sites

Boa noite a todos.

Gostaria de informar aos usuários que o fórum é exclusivamente para tirar dúvidas, sendo que o contato profissional deverá ser feito impreterivelmente de forma privada.

 

Quanto a dúvida de nosso usuário, a criação arquivo texto é feito atravez das funções Open e Put as quais podem ser encontradas Nesse Tópico

 

Paulo Mendes.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Obrigado pela informação...

 

Mais preciso de um sistema que importe ok.

pega o tpo de coluna e pula para a outra etc..

como no que mande.

 

contato: junior@infoshop.eti.br

 

Boa noite a todos.

Gostaria de informar aos usuários que o fórum é exclusivamente para tirar dúvidas, sendo que o contato profissional deverá ser feito impreterivelmente de forma privada.

 

Quanto a dúvida de nosso usuário, a criação arquivo texto é feito atravez das funções Open e Put as quais podem ser encontradas Nesse Tópico

 

Paulo Mendes.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Cara não sei bem qual o teu cenário, mas se eu fosse você reformatava o arquivo.

Se você passar o arquivo para o formato:

<Coluna1>;..<ColunaN>;

<Campo1>;..<CampoN>;

.

.

N(linhas)

 

Fica mais fácil trabalhar, você pode criar um método que faça essa reformatação do arquivo antes de importar.

 

O SQL Server tem ferramentas de importação de várias fontes de dados, com o arquivo formatado nestas condições(como acima) você nem precisa programar mais nada, as ferramentas do SQL já fazem a importação pra você.

 

Se isso for um processo mensal ou coisa do tipo, você pode criar um programa que faça a reformatação e um job pra ficar lendo os arquivos reformatados e importando.

 

Não sei se ajudei, mas a intenção foi boa =)

Compartilhar este post


Link para o post
Compartilhar em outros sites

Wagner, obrigado por tentar ajudar.

 

Mas repare na data do tópico, é muito antigo. É possível que os membros envolvidos no tópico nem frequentem mais o fórum.

 

Evite ressuscitar tópicos muito antigos, ok. http://forum.imasters.com.br/public/style_emoticons/default/thumbsup.gif

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.